The Affenhuahua is a cross between the Affenpinscher and the Chihuahua. This mixed breed is small in size, weighing between 4 to 10 pounds and standing at around 6 to 9 inches tall. The Affenhuahua has a compact body, with a round head, large eyes, and a short muzzle. They have a short to medium length coat that can come in a variety of colors, including black, brown, cream, and white.
Known for their playful and lively personality, the Affenhuahua is a fun-loving and energetic breed. They are affectionate towards their owners and enjoy spending time with their families. This breed is also known to be quite intelligent and can be easy to train with positive reinforcement techniques. However, they can be a bit stubborn at times, so consistency is key in training them.
Despite their small size, the Affenhuahua is an active breed that requires regular exercise to stay happy and healthy. Daily walks and playtime are essential to keep them mentally and physically stimulated. In terms of grooming, they have a low shedding coat that requires weekly brushing to keep it looking its best.
The Bouvier des Flandres is a large and sturdy breed that originated in Belgium. They are known for their distinctive appearance, with a thick double coat that comes in various colors such as black, fawn, brindle, and grey. This breed typically weighs between 70 to 110 pounds and stands at around 23 to 28 inches tall. The Bouvier des Flandres has a square and muscular body, with a broad head and expressive eyes.
The Bouvier des Flandres is a loyal and protective breed that forms strong bonds with their families. They are intelligent and easily trainable, making them well-suited for various tasks such as herding, guard work, and search and rescue. While they can be aloof with strangers, they are gentle and affectionate with their loved ones.
As a working breed, the Bouvier des Flandres requires regular exercise to keep them mentally and physically stimulated. Daily walks, playtime, and training sessions are essential to prevent boredom and behavioral issues. In terms of grooming, they have a dense double coat that requires regular brushing to prevent mats and tangles.
